I'm new to the site as well. I am going to buy the 2555 or the 2565 4WD with loader. I am very much looking to enjoy the site and all its wisdome.

Welcome! If the budget allows, the 2565 has a heftier front and rear axle and three-point area. It is just a bit stouter all the way around. That being said, we sell more 2555 than 2565 models perhaps due to price and the availability of the HST. It depends upon usage really.

I bought mine from Burnips in Three Rivers. They have been good to work with. I had a JD 790 prior to this and dealing with the local green dealer was sometimes frustrating. Walk in the showroom and salesmen ignore you kind of thing. Burnips is not like that. They also have a store in Coopersville. I've had my 1538 into the service department three times so far; once to do the 50 hr filter and oil change and install hyd remotes, once to install back hoe and the final to diagnose an engine fault light. They share some of the specific tools for certain tractors between the 3 locations but have a nightly shuttle between them to get parts / tools where they need to be. Since they are a newer store there is some lack of knowledge about some of the items, but they are willing to research and learn. I recommend them.
